Ben has $3.40 consisting of quarters and dimes. How many coins of each kind does he have if he has 22 coins?

Show a system of equation to represent the word problem.

Answer:

There are 8 quarters and 14 dimes.

Explanation:

Let there are x quarters.

and y dimes.

Also as we know,

1 quarter= 0.25 dollar

Hence, x quarter= $ 0.25x

and 1 dime= $ 0.10

Hence, y dimes= $ 0.10y

  • Ben has $3.40 consisting of quarters and dimes.

This means that:

0.25x+0.10y=3.40

Also, in non-decimal form it could be written as:

25x+10y=340

  • He has 22 coins

This means that:

x+y=22

Now on solving it graphically we see what is the point of intersection of the two lines or system of linear equations.

We get the point of intersection as: (8,14)

i.e. x=8 and y=14

Hence, there are 8 quarters.

and 14 dimes.
